Output a1bec14aadea0357821c0525b913040b348db6f1d778683daa1db04c8d61c4e2:112

value
9760439
script pubkey
OP_0 OP_PUSHBYTES_20 5ab6d7b6cd29a9c9b4183ea34f2fb4944a17aa65
address
bc1qt2md0dkd9x5undqc86357ta5j39p02n9vmku3y
transaction
a1bec14aadea0357821c0525b913040b348db6f1d778683daa1db04c8d61c4e2
spent
true